What to check before for buildings near colleges in Brooklyn

  • Start with commute reality: note the closest campus area and map typical travel time at your move-in day and hours.
  • Use building pages to compare amenities, building policies, and any patterns called out by renters (for example, noise, maintenance response, or package handling).
  • If you plan to share or co-sign, confirm occupancy rules and lease terms in writing before paying any fees.
  • Fees matter beyond rent: ask about deposits, move-in costs, and recurring charges tied to the specific building and unit.
  • For any application, verify what’s included (utilities, internet access, laundry access) and whether the quoted rent reflects the full monthly cost.
